Martial Arts is a Great Option for Children with Focus Problems
As a parent, you may be struggling with finding an activity for your child that not only keeps them active and engaged but also helps improve their focus and attention. If you're looking for a solution that combines physical activity and mental stimulation, martial arts might be the perfect choice.
In this blog post, we'll explore why martial arts is great for children with focus problems and how it can help them develop important life skills.
Physical Exercise
Physical exercise is essential for maintaining a healthy body and mind. Martial arts is an excellent form of exercise that can help children build strength, flexibility, and coordination. Through regular training, children will also improve their endurance and develop a sense of discipline, which can be applied to other areas of their life.
Focus and Concentration
Martial arts requires children to focus their attention on the movements, techniques, and drills they're practicing. This type of training helps children improve their focus and concentration, which is especially important for those with attention problems. By learning to stay focused during training, children can transfer these skills to other areas of their life, such as school and homework.
Confidence and Self-Esteem
Martial arts training can help children build confidence and improve their self-esteem. As they learn new techniques and progress in their training, children develop a sense of accomplishment and pride. This can have a positive impact on their overall well-being and help them feel more confident in other areas of their life.
Discipline and Respect
Martial arts training is built on a foundation of discipline and respect. Children learn to respect their instructors, training partners, and themselves. This type of training helps children develop self-control and teaches them how to handle difficult situations with calmness and composure.
Social Skills
Martial arts training provides a social environment for children to interact with others. This can be especially important for children with focus problems, who may struggle to make friends and connect with their peers. By training with others, children have the opportunity to develop their social skills and make new friends.
Martial arts is a great option for children with focus problems. It provides physical exercise, helps improve focus and concentration, builds confidence and self-esteem, teaches discipline and respect, and provides a social environment for children to interact with others. With the many benefits martial arts has to offer, it's no wonder why so many parents are choosing this activity for their children.
